PINSPECT_MEMORY_CALLBACK回调函数 (roerrorapi.h)

提供指向 RoInspectCapturedStackBackTrace 函数使用的回调的函数指针。

语法

PINSPECT_MEMORY_CALLBACK PinspectMemoryCallback;

HRESULT PinspectMemoryCallback(
  [in]  void *context,
  [in]  UINT_PTR readAddress,
  [in]  UINT32 length,
  [out] BYTE *buffer
)
{...}

parameters

[in] context

提供给 RoInspectCapturedStackBackTrace 函数的 自定义上下文数据。

[in] readAddress

要从中读取数据的地址。

[in] length

要读取的字节数,从 readAddress 开始。

[out] buffer

接收读取的字节副本的缓冲区。

返回值

如果此回调函数成功,则返回 S_OK。 否则,将返回 HRESULT 错误代码。

要求

   
最低受支持的客户端 Windows 8.1 [仅限桌面应用]
最低受支持的服务器 Windows Server 2012 R2 [仅限桌面应用]
目标平台 Windows
标头 roerrorapi.h

请参阅

RoInspectCapturedStackBackTrace